The SCF Barents is the second vessel in a series of three 174,000-cbm new-generation Atlanticmax LNG carriers ordered by PAO Sovcomflot (SCF Group) in 2018.
Delivered on yesterday (14 September), the vessel has since embarked upon her maiden voyage under a long-term time charter agreement with one of Shellâs subsidiaries.
Commenting on the delivery of SCF Barents, President and CEO of SCF Group, Igor Tonkovidov, highlighted the âlong-standing partnershipâ with Shell, which is amongst the largest charterers of SCFâs vessels.
âThe delivery of SCF Barents, which will operate under a long-term time charter to Shell, serves as a logical next step in our mutually beneficial cooperation. It is also important to note that growing our fleet of gas carriers is a strategic priority for SCF Group,â said Tonkovidov.
âWith the delivery of SCF Barents, we now have 15 gas carriers in operation, with another 16 under construction. Thus, two-thirds of all vessels currently ordered by SCF Group are destined to expand our gas fleet,â Tonkovidov added.
The SCF Barents follows the first vessel of the three-vessel series, SCF La Perouse, which was delivered in February 2020, and has since begun a long-term time charter with Total.
